Before death came to collect Ava Berry in the form of one mouth-watering
fallen angel named Suriyel, she was a newly divorced, 51-year-old caterer with
a passion for all things Elvis and Paula Deen. Thanks to Suriyel and his magic
amulet, she’s now in the body of her 20-something niece who died on the same
night. Ava’s hell-bent on catching a killer even if it means not being heaven-
bound anymore.

Fending off a possessed dumpster and an Elvis impersonator while dealing
with her deceased mother who’s back as her pimped-out, Hoverround®-riding,
guardian angel, are a lot easier than keeping her heart away from Suriyel. The
soul-collector risks being thrown back into the center of the earth so he can
protect and teach Ava to use the powers of the amulet. Good thing, too,
because she soon finds herself using it to save his life and what remains of her
lineage.

Ava wakes up and believe she is having a kind of out of body experience, but it soon comes to light that she is out of body alright, but not in the way she thinks and when an angel comes to collect her, she isn’t at all happy about the situation;

““I refuse to let you do a beam-me-up-Scotty with me if it’s the last thing I do!” With my free hand, I reached for the post by the headboard and hung on with all my might. “No sir-ee. I’m not going anywhere with… whatever you call yourself, period!””


Ava refuses to go anywhere until she finds out how she got into this situation, who killed her. Ava teams up with the angel, Suriyel, making a deal that is he helps her find her killer, then she will go willingly with him. Suriyel gives Ava the opportunity to live again, to inhabit another body in order to aid her in finding her killer, a younger body at that, her nieces. But things don’t go to plan with something trying to kill Ava again putting the ones around her in danger. I got a little confused at times with the story, it isn’t what I expected that’s for sure. I liked the humorous moments throughout this read but it just didn’t suck me in or enthral me.
